Transaction 3d8b80907362046863c0580b90abb1cd4e9b78d692a1f09a85ccd95ae230edeb
1 Input
1 Output
-
3d8b80907362046863c0580b90abb1cd4e9b78d692a1f09a85ccd95ae230edeb:0
- value
- 40000
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 d6bfbc7e13e3b2a2de91a1e2d4fd26de585d652fd4262356703684bba7c722e3
- address
- tb1p66lmclsnuwe29h53583dflfxmev96ef06snzx4nsx6zthf78yt3se3fpr5